In Bayer North America Executive Moves, Consumer Chief Lockwood-Taylor Adds US Business Top Post

Lockwood-Taylor will start post on 1 August while continuing as North America consumer health chief. Also in North America, Dave Tomasi adds chief commercial officer post and Jeff Jarrett moves to chief marketing officer.

Nov 2, 2019 San Francisco / CA / USA - Bayer offices located in Mission Bay District; Bayer AG is a German multinational pharmaceutical and life sciences company, one of the largest in the world

More from Leadership

More from HBW Insight